Start your trip by immersing yourself in the rich history and charm of Amsterdam's Historic Center. In the morning, visit the Anne Frank House, where you can learn about the life of Anne Frank and the history of the Holocaust. Afterward, take a leisurely walk along the picturesque canals, admiring the beautiful architecture and stopping by the iconic Dam Square. In the afternoon, explore the Van Gogh Museum, home to the largest collection of artworks by Vincent van Gogh. As the evening sets in, head to the vibrant Leidseplein Square, known for its lively nightlife and bustling atmosphere.
Immerse yourself in Amsterdam's vibrant art and culture scene on your second day. Start your morning with a visit to the Rijksmuseum, home to an extensive collection of Dutch masterpieces, including Rembrandt's "The Night Watch." Afterward, head to the Jordaan neighborhood, known for its picturesque streets and charming boutiques. In the afternoon, explore the quirky and unique exhibits at the NEMO Science Museum, perfect for a fun and educational experience. As the evening approaches, make your way to the trendy De Pijp neighborhood, where you can enjoy a wide array of international cuisines and vibrant nightlife.
Escape the city and explore the countryside with a day trip to Zaanse Schans and Keukenhof. In the morning, visit Zaanse Schans, a picturesque village famous for its well-preserved windmills and traditional Dutch houses. Take a stroll along the canals, visit the working windmills, and learn about traditional crafts such as cheese-making and clog carving. In the afternoon, head to Keukenhof, the world's largest flower garden. Marvel at the stunning displays of tulips and other spring flowers, explore the themed gardens, and take memorable photos. Return to Amsterdam in the evening and unwind with a relaxing canal cruise.
On your final day, explore the modern and alternative side of Amsterdam. Start your morning by visiting the EYE Film Institute, where you can learn about Dutch cinema and enjoy a panoramic view of the city from the rooftop terrace. In the afternoon, head to the vibrant neighborhood of De Wallen, also known as the Red Light District, to experience its unique atmosphere and learn about its history. In the evening, explore the trendy neighborhood of Noord, located on the other side of the IJ river. Enjoy street art, live music, and delicious food at the creative hotspot of NDSM Wharf.
While exploring Amsterdam, make sure to visit the Begijnhof, a tranquil courtyard hidden in the city center, offering a peaceful retreat from the bustling streets. Another hidden gem is the Hortus Botanicus, one of the oldest botanical gardens in the world, where you can immerse yourself in the beauty of nature. For a local favorite, head to the Foodhallen, a converted tram depot housing a variety of food stalls serving delicious international cuisine. It's an ideal spot to enjoy a meal, grab a drink, or simply soak up the lively atmosphere.
